Overview
The Madhya Pradesh Police Department has officially released the admit card for the Constable Band recruitment process for the year 2026. This update is crucial for all applicants who have successfully registered for the 679 available positions. The hall ticket serves as the primary document for entry into the skill evaluation stages, and candidates are advised to download it promptly from the official portal to avoid any last-minute technical issues.
Key Responsibilities
- Candidates must participate in the skill-based evaluation rounds as scheduled by the department.
- Applicants are required to demonstrate proficiency in band-specific musical instruments during the performance test.
- Successful candidates will undergo a physical measurement verification to ensure they meet the department's standards.
- Participants must present all original educational and identity documents during the verification stage.
- Candidates are expected to follow all instructions provided by the invigilators at the test center.
- Maintaining professional conduct throughout the interview and performance evaluation process is mandatory.

How to Apply
- Navigate to the official website at mponline.gov.in.
- Locate the section dedicated to Admit Cards or Hall Tickets on the homepage.
- Log in using your registered username and password created during the application phase.
- Once the dashboard opens, click on the link to download your admit card.
- Review all personal and exam-related details for accuracy.
- Download the file and save it securely on your device.
- Print a clear copy of the admit card to carry to the examination center.
- Keep a digital and physical copy for future reference throughout the selection process.
